Bentonite
According to its transliteration, Bentonite is a hydrated clay mineral primarily composed of montmorillonite. Its official molecular formula is Nax(H2O)4(Al2-xMg0.83)Si4O10)(OH)2. Thanks to its unique characteristics, Bentonite is utilized across various industrial sectors owing to its properties including swelling, adhesion, adsorption, catalysis, thixotropy, suspension, and cation exchange.

Bentonite Ore This versatile mineral's quality and application are largely determined by the content and type of montmorillonite and its crystal chemical properties. Thus, its exploitation and application must be tailored to each specific mine and function. Practical uses include the production of active clay, converting calcium-based to sodium-based Bentonite, creating drilling grouting for petroleum exploration, substituting starch in the spinning, printing, and dyeing industries, and applying inner and outer wall coatings in construction materials. Additionally, it is utilized for preparing organic Bentonite, synthesizing 4A zeolite, producing white carbon black and more.

Product Description:
Bentonite, known as the 'universal' clay, is a prized non-metallic mineral offering exceptional process performance such as dispersion, suspension, thixotropy, rheology, adsorption, plasticity, adhesion, and cation exchange. It serves as binders, suspension agents, thixotropic agents, plasticizers, thickeners, lubricants, flocculants, stabilizers, catalysts, purification and decolorization agents, clarifying agents, fillers, adsorbents, and chemical carriers. Consequently, Bentonite finds wide application in petroleum, metallurgy, chemical industries, casting, construction, plastics, rubber, coatings, and light industries.

The following are the primary applications of Bentonite:
1. Casting: Used as molding sand adhesive. Suitable for both calcium-based or sodium-based Bentonite.
2. Metallurgy: Acts as an iron concentrate pellet binder. Utilizes calcium-based or sodium-based Bentonite.
3. Drilling Mud: Prepares drilling mud suspension with high rheological and thixotropic properties and serves as a drilling release agent. Employs calcium-based, sodium-based, and organic Bentonite.
4. Food Industry: Used for decolorization and purification of animal and vegetable oils, wine and juice clarification, beer stabilization and saccharification, and sugar juice purification. Utilizes activated clay or sodium-based Bentonite.
5. Petroleum: Functions as a catalyst carrier for refining, waxing, decolorization, and purification of petroleum, fats, and kerosene. Active clay or calcium-based Bentonite is used as stabilizers for asphalt surfaces, while lithium-based and organic Bentonite are used as thickeners for lubricating oil.
6. Agriculture: Utilized as soil amendments, additives for mixed fertilizers, feed additives, adhesives, and for animal enclosure soil for deodorizing and disinfecting.
7. Chemical Industry: Acts as carriers of catalysts, pesticides, and insecticides; fillers for rubber and plastic products; desiccants; filters; detergents; and additives for soap and toothpaste. Also serves as thixotropic thickeners for coatings and inks, and anti-settling aids for paints and inks. Uses activated clay, sodium-based, and lithium-based Bentonite, as well as organic Bentonite.
8. Industrial Construction: Employed in industrial wastewater treatment, swimming pool water purification, food industry waste treatment, adsorption treatment agents for radioactive waste, soil and water conservation, sand fixation, and more. Uses activated clay and sodium-based Bentonite.
9. Architecture: Serves as waterproof and anti-seepage materials, cement mixtures, concrete plasticizers, and additives. Various types of Bentonite are utilized for these applications.

Features
 

1.Main features of bentonite:

(1)High concentration and pulping rate;
(2)Excellent ability to transport drilling cuttings in suspension; (3)It has a long acting time and keep the mud stable for a long time after mixing.
(4)It can form a thin and dense filter cake layer to prevent mud leakage;
(5)It can maintain the integrity of horizontal drilling to the maximum extent;
(6)It can eliminate the hydration expansion of clay and shale, cement adhesion and prevent drilling tools from sticking.

Application
 
Calcium Bentonite Powder for Optimal Soil Health and pH Management

1. In drilling, create superior drilling mud suspensions featuring outstanding rheological and thixotropic characteristics.
2. In mechanical manufacturing, it serves as an excellent casting sand and binder, effectively preventing sand inclusion and peeling in castings. This reduces the scrap rate and ensures casting precision and smoothness.
3. In the paper industry, it is utilized as a paper filler to significantly enhance the brightness and quality of paper sheets.
4. In textile printing and dyeing, it acts as an anti-static coating, replacing starch for sizing and serving as an efficient printing coating.
5. Thanks to its exceptional physical and chemical properties, Bentonite is used as a purification and decolorization agent, binder, thixotropic agent, suspension agent, stabilizer, filler, feed, and catalyst across agriculture, light industry, and more.
6. Bentonite is also employed in waterproofing applications, such as in bentonite waterproof blankets and boards. These materials are mechanically fixed and used in underground environments with pH values from 4 to 10. For areas with high salt content, modified bentonite should be used after thorough testing and approval.
